6.2 Check Event Monitor Logs

The Hik IP Receiver Pro displays the real-time events triggered by the communication between it
and the third-party system. On the Event Monitor page, you can view the event details including
the access protocol between it and the third-party system, the time at which an event happens,
communication bugs, etc. Each event type is marked by different colors for attention. For example,
you will be noticed quickly when there are communication bugs between the Hik IP Receiver Pro
and the third-party system.
Click Automation Output → Event Monitor .
The real-time events triggered by communications between the Hik IP Receiver Pro and third-party
system are displayed.
Different event types are marked by different colors:
Red
Communication failure between the Hik IP Receiver Pro and third-party system. The Hik IP
Receiver Pro cannot get communication results.
Yellow
The third-party system responding to the message sent by the Hik IP Receiver Pro timed out.
White
The communication between the Hik IP Receiver Pro and the third-party system goes well.
